Understanding CVE-2024-36901: A Detailed Guide

Hello and welcome to our comprehensive explanation of CVE-2024-36901, a recent vulnerability identified in the Linux kernel. This article aims to demystify the technical details and explain the significance of this vulnerability to users and administrators of Linux systems. Our goal is to provide you with a clear understanding of the issue and guide you on how to secure your systems effectively.

What is CVE-2024-36901?

CVE-2024-36901 is a security vulnerability identified within the IPv6 component of the Linux kernel, specifically a function called ip6_output(). It has been marked with a severity level of MEDIUM and possesses a score of 5.5, reflecting its potential impact on the integrity of Linux systems, but highlighting that its exploitation is not straightforward.

Technical Explanation of the Vulnerability

At the heart of CVE-2024-36901 is a flaw where the function ip6_dst_idev() could return NULL in ip6_output(). The IPv6 networking stack in Linux typically handles NULL values in data structures without issue. However, in this instance, the NULL dereference was not properly managed, leading to potential system crashes or improper handling of data packets.

The issue was initially reported by syzbot, a bot that continuously stress-tests the Linux kernel by generating random system calls to expose bugs. This reported problem could potentially lead to a general protection fault, causing a crash and a denial of service (DoS), significantly impacting the availability and reliability of systems running the affected Linux kernel versions.

Affected Versions

Linux systems running kernel versions up to, and including, 6.9.0-rc5-syzkaller-00157-g6a30653b604a are affected by this vulnerability. If you have a system running a version within this range, it is crucial to assess your exposure to this issue and take appropriate security measures.

Importance of Patching

Patching CVE-2024-36901 is essential to prevent the denial of service attacks that can result from this vulnerability. Linux system administrators should prioritize obtaining and applying security updates that address this issue to help ensure that their systems remain stable and secure.

How to Secure Your System

For patch management on Linux servers, consider accessing services like LinuxPatch, a platform dedicated to providing timely and managed security updates tailored for diverse Linux environments. Visit LinuxPatch to learn more about how you can automate and manage patches efficiently, reducing the window of opportunity for attackers to exploit vulnerabilities such as CVE-2024-36901.

Conclusion

Understanding and addressing vulnerabilities like CVE-2024-36901 is crucial for maintaining the security and reliability of your IT infrastructures. Remember, staying informed and proactive in applying security patches is your best defense against potential cyber threats.

Thank you for taking the time to read through this guide. If you have additional questions or require further assistance with your vulnerability management strategy, feel free to visit our website at LinuxPatch.com, your partner in securing Linux environments.